The Anti-Corruption Bureau today caught a government officer while allegedly accepting a bribe of Rs 10,000 in Reddygudem Mandal Tehsildar Office in Krishna district.
DSP V Gopalakrishna said that R V Subramanyam, Junior Assistant, had allegedly demanded Rs 12,000 for giving birth certificates of the complainant's daughters.
Later he settled on Rs 10,000. ACB officials laid a trap after the complaiant approached them and arrested Subramanyam this evening.
